Google embraces zero-knowledge proof tech for enhanced privateness in digital IDs



Google has added Zero-Information Proof (ZKP) know-how to its Google Pockets platform to strengthen consumer privateness in digital identification programs.

The corporate confirmed this function is energetic and allows customers to confirm their age throughout apps, web sites, and gadgets, with out disclosing private info.

Based on Google:

“We are going to use ZKP the place acceptable in different Google merchandise and associate with apps like Bumble, which is able to use digital IDs from Google Pockets to confirm consumer identification and ZKP to confirm age.”

Moreover, the tech big has plans to open-source its ZKP instruments, permitting different pockets suppliers and builders to undertake privacy-first authentication programs.

This improvement stems from Google’s effort to create a privacy-preserving identification layer, particularly as extra on-line providers like courting platforms require age validation. It defined:

“Given many websites and providers require age verification, we needed to develop a system that not solely verifies age, however does it in a method that protects your privateness.”

Zero-knowledge proofs are cryptographic instruments that permit one celebration to substantiate a reality to a different with out revealing the underlying information.

Notably, ZKPs are already utilized in blockchain ecosystems resembling Cardano and Ethereum to allow non-public transactions, identification verification, and scalable options. Vitalik Buterin, Ethereum’s co-founder, has additionally highlighted their potential in areas like tamper-proof voting, provide chain monitoring, and information safety.

In the meantime, Google’s adoption of ZKPs has acquired reward from the crypto neighborhood, a lot of whom see it as validation for a know-how lengthy championed within the blockchain area.

Rob Viglione, co-founder of Horizen Labs, instructed CryptoSlate that Google’s transfer is “a transparent sign that privacy-driven improvements have gotten mainstream and that zero-knowledge will grow to be one among crypto’s most transformative use instances [that benefits] on a regular basis customers.

He added:

“It’s thrilling to see main corporations acknowledge that privateness shouldn’t be a luxurious or an afterthought; it ought to be a default.”
